Output 65439106c3284137d88704a84942ec8b180655a53d2d62f052c717ee02c63d68:43

value
675735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2945da88362023e37840c19433ffb9e4047d35 OP_EQUAL
address
3Mm82SD4DZEnkgdN42wwpuk58Uz2CEq8wk
transaction
65439106c3284137d88704a84942ec8b180655a53d2d62f052c717ee02c63d68
spent
true